Hydro excavation uses high-pressure water to cut and liquefy soil. The liquified soil is then removed via a high-volume vacuum. Both the water and soil from the excavation are contained in a truck that hauls the material to a more desirable location.
Safety is the primary reason to choose hydro excavation. There are thousands of excavation accidents in the United States each year, most of which arise due to the imprecision and inefficiency of mechanical and hydraulic excavating equipment. In addition, hydro excavation can lead to significant cost savings, as the safer, faster, and more precise method of exposing delicate underground structures can greatly reduce job site error.
Yes, hydro excavation and hydrovac are interchangeable terms. Hydrovac is simply a trendy term for referring to hydro excavation trucks.
Any business doing foundation or utility work can benefit from hydro excavation. Some common industries include public utilities, oil/gas, food/beverage, and construction.
Digging and exposing underground utilities (daylighting), digging narrow trenches to install cables (slot trenching), debris removal, and cold-weather digging are a few common uses of hydro excavation. It can also be used for industrial cleanup.
